Transaction e1afdb3c3a8b150a32ace81a2a5f81cfd2253ab839263b64a52b3168a40c6951
1 Input
1 Output
-
e1afdb3c3a8b150a32ace81a2a5f81cfd2253ab839263b64a52b3168a40c6951:0
- value
- 136762
- script pubkey
- OP_0 OP_PUSHBYTES_20 425b3bf9bc79a53a2a844bd16a54d8fdf6497d70
- address
- bc1qgfdnh7du0xjn525yf0gk54xclhmyjlts73uu3u